Publications

Schulz, A., Kilburn, V.. and Charette, M.R. 2025. Continuous breeding of the Red-eyed Treefrog Agalychnis callidryas (Cope, 1862) during the dry season. (in press).

Martin, V., Kilburn, V., Charette, M.R, and Miller, B. 2024. First record of leucism in the Spix’s Disc-winged Bat Thyroptera tricolor (Chiroptera: Thyropteridae) in Belize. Neotropical Biology and Conservation: https://doi.org/10.3897/neotropical.20.e140661 (25 Nov 2024).

Jones, D., Kilburn, V., and Charette, M.R. Note: Range Extension, Death Feigning Behavior, and Scale Iridescence in the Ringneck Coffee Snake, Ninia diademata (Baird and Girard 1853). Reptiles and Amphibians. (Vol. 31 No. 1 (2024): Reptiles & Amphibians)

Sayers, C. et. al. 2023. Mercury in Neotropical birds: a synthesis and prospectus on 15 years of exposure data. Submitted. Ecotoxicology. Ecotoxicology 32(8). 

Jones, D., Charette, M.R., and Kilburn, V. 2020. First record of Coyote, Canis latrans (Carnivora, Canidae), in the Mayan Mountain region of Belize. Check List

16(2): 303-306. https://checklist.pensoft.net/article/48499/

Soriero, V.R., Wooldridge, R.L., Harmsen, B.J., Mathieu Charette, M.R., and Kilburn, V. 2018. Range extension of Northern Naked-tailed Armadillo, Cabassous centralis Miller, 1899 (Mammalia, Cingulata, Chlamyphoridae), in Belize. Check List 14 (5): 839–843 https://doi.org/10.15560/14.5.839 .

Hipfner, M., Addison, B., and Charette, M. 2013. Dietary segregation between two cohabiting species of sparrows revealed with stable isotope analysis. Canadian Journal of Zoology. 91:37-40, https://doi.org/10.1139/cjz-2012-0103 

Charette, M.R., Calmé, S., Pelletier, F. 2011. Observation of nocturnal feeding in Black vultures (Coragyps atratus). Journal of Raptor Research. 45(3): 279-280.

Hipfner, M., Charette, M., and Blackburn, G. 2007. Subcolony variation in breeding success in the Tufted Puffin, its association with foraging ecology, and its implications. The Auk. 124(4):1149-1157.

Jones, I., Major, H., Charette, M., and Diamond, A. 2007. Variation in the diet of introduced Norway Rats to Kiska island Alaska. Journal of Zoology. 271(4): 463-468.
